A score of Newcastle United fans have taken to Twitter to react to claims that Newcastle have joined some European heavyweights in the race for Argentine striker Mauro Icardi.
According to reports from the Daily Mail, Newcastle are eyeing up the forward to compete with the likes of Callum Wilson and Joelinton – but could face competition for his signature from the likes of Juventus and Tottenham.
The links with the hitman comes following the completion of a consortium takeover spearheaded by PCP Capital Partners.
The change in ownership, that has seen the club part with Mike Ashley after a 14-year tenure, has led Newcastle to become one of the richest clubs in the world due to their backing by the Saudi-owned Public Investment Fund (PIF).
